Understanding Mobility Scooters
Mobility scooters are battery-operated lorries developed to assist individuals with limited mobility. They are available in different styles, each customized to meet specific needs, ranging from compact designs for indoor use to rugged scooters suggested for outdoor surface.
Kinds Of Mobility ScootersClass 2 Scooters: These are designed for use on pavements and have a speed limitation of 4 miles per hour. They usually have a more compact design.Class 3 Scooters: Suitable for roadway usage, these scooters can travel at accelerate to 8 miles per hour. They are ideal for those who want to travel longer distances.Pavement-Safe Scooters: These models can be used in both indoor and outside environments, balancing speed and size for maximum adaptability.Key Features to Consider

Additional Costs to Consider
While concentrating on the preliminary cost of the scooter is crucial, budgeting for the following can help prevent surprises later on:
Maintenance: Regular upkeep is crucial for the longevity of your scooter.Batteries: Replacement batteries can be pricey, so aspect this into your budget.Insurance coverage: Some individuals choose to guarantee their scooters versus theft or damage, which can add to annual costs.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)1. What is the average cost of a mobility scooter?
The cost of mobility scooters can vary anywhere from ₤ 500 to ₤ 3,000, depending on the model and functions.
2. Are used mobility scooters a trusted option?
Yes, as long as they have actually been effectively kept. It's vital to examine the scooter, examine the battery life, and ask for any service records.
3. Can I tailor my mobility scooter?
Lots of models enable for customization, consisting of choices for various seat types, accessories, and colors.
4. What is the life-span of a mobility scooter?
Normally, with appropriate care, mobility scooters can last between 5 to 15 years.
